
Ingredients:
• 300 g – Meat either Beef or Mutton cut into small pieces
• 3 – Onions chopped
• 2 tsp – chopped Mint
• 1 tsp – pepper powder
• Salt to taste
• 2 tbsp – Tomato sauce
• 1 tsp – Butter
• 1 Egg beaten
• Yolk of one Egg
• 3 tbsp – oil
• 3 tbsp – bread crumbs
Method:
- Wash the meat and cook in a little water with some salt till soft.
- Remove from the heat and cool.
- When the meat is cold, shred into very small flakes.
- Mix in the chopped onions, mint, pepper, salt, sauce, butter and the egg yolk.
- Form into oval shapes and flatten with a knife.
- Heat the oil in a flat pan.
- Dip each croquette in the beaten egg, roll in bread crumbs then shallow fry on both sides till brown.
- Drain and serve with mashed potatoes.
